Publication number: 20100113250Abstract: An ultra hard alloy is a hard material with a high degree of toughness. Small amounts of various materials are added to achieve these properties. One such material is vanadium carbide (VC). However, a crushed carbide raw material has a large grain size, meaning the properties of a product cannot be improved uniformly. Vanadium trioxide (V2O3) was substituted for a carbide as one of the structural raw materials for a material used in producing a tool such as a hob. Because vanadium trioxide is softer than vanadium carbide, it can be readily converted to fine grains in the ball mill mixing process performed during raw material preparation. As a result, the effects of the uniformly dispersed vanadium trioxide results in improved hardness for the sintered ultra hard alloy.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 28, 2008Publication date: May 6, 2010Applicant: MITSUBISHI HEAVY INDUSTRIES , LTD.Inventors: Hideo Tsunoda, Yoichi Tajitsu, Yukio Kodama, Taiji Kikuchi

Patent number: 6716897Abstract: A colored composition for color filter contains a colorant carrier formed of a transparent resin, a precursor of a transparent resin or a mixture thereof, and a green colorant dispersed in the colorant carrier. The green colorant contains a first halogenated metallophthalocyanine pigment having copper as a central metal, and at least one second halogenated metallophthalocyanine pigment having, as a central metal, a metal selected from the group consisting of Mg, Al, Si, Ti, V, Mn, Fe, Co, Ni, Zn, Ge and Sn. The content of the second halogenated metallophthalocyanine pigment is within a range of 1 to 80 mol % based on a total amount of the green colorant. Also disclosed is a color filter including at least one red filter segment, at least one blue filter segment, and at least one green filter segment. At least one green filter segment is prepared from the above-mentioned colored composition.Type: GrantFiled: December 19, 2001Date of Patent: April 6, 2004Assignee: Toyo Ink Mfg. Patent number: 5935269Abstract: When encoding data received by a dividing circuit and to be included in a CRC code word, the data is divided by a generator polynomial and remainder data resulting from the division is output from a plurality of parallel data output terminals of the dividing circuit. The remainder data is added to a CRC intrinsic value and "0" information in the adder to produce a sum. The sum is a CRC code for a CRC code word to be transmitted. When detecting code errors, data from a CRC code word is received by the dividing circuit, where the data is divided by the generator polynomial, and remainder data resulting from the division is output from the respective parallel data output terminals. The remainder data is added to the CRC intrinsic value and CRC code in the adder to produce a sum, and the sum is processed by a logical sum circuit to produce a logical sum output as a CRC flag.Type: GrantFiled: March 26, 1997Date of Patent: August 10, 1999Assignee: Mitsubishi Denki Kabushiki KaishaInventors: Yukio Kodama, Kazuo Murakami
